PoeBotCreateMutation.graphql 1.6 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273
  1. mutation CreateBotMain_poeBotCreate_Mutation(
  2. $model: String!
  3. $handle: String!
  4. $prompt: String!
  5. $isPromptPublic: Boolean!
  6. $introduction: String!
  7. $description: String!
  8. $profilePictureUrl: String
  9. $apiUrl: String
  10. $apiKey: String
  11. $isApiBot: Boolean
  12. $hasLinkification: Boolean
  13. $hasMarkdownRendering: Boolean
  14. $hasSuggestedReplies: Boolean
  15. $isPrivateBot: Boolean
  16. ) {
  17. poeBotCreate(model: $model, handle: $handle, promptPlaintext: $prompt, isPromptPublic: $isPromptPublic, introduction: $introduction, description: $description, profilePicture: $profilePictureUrl, apiUrl: $apiUrl, apiKey: $apiKey, isApiBot: $isApiBot, hasLinkification: $hasLinkification, hasMarkdownRendering: $hasMarkdownRendering, hasSuggestedReplies: $hasSuggestedReplies, isPrivateBot: $isPrivateBot) {
  18. status
  19. bot {
  20. id
  21. ...BotHeader_bot
  22. }
  23. }
  24. }
  25. fragment BotHeader_bot on Bot {
  26. displayName
  27. messageLimit {
  28. dailyLimit
  29. }
  30. ...BotImage_bot
  31. ...BotLink_bot
  32. ...IdAnnotation_node
  33. ...botHelpers_useViewerCanAccessPrivateBot
  34. ...botHelpers_useDeletion_bot
  35. }
  36. fragment BotImage_bot on Bot {
  37. displayName
  38. ...botHelpers_useDeletion_bot
  39. ...BotImage_useProfileImage_bot
  40. }
  41. fragment BotImage_useProfileImage_bot on Bot {
  42. image {
  43. __typename
  44. ... on LocalBotImage {
  45. localName
  46. }
  47. ... on UrlBotImage {
  48. url
  49. }
  50. }
  51. ...botHelpers_useDeletion_bot
  52. }
  53. fragment BotLink_bot on Bot {
  54. displayName
  55. }
  56. fragment IdAnnotation_node on Node {
  57. __isNode: __typename
  58. id
  59. }
  60. fragment botHelpers_useDeletion_bot on Bot {
  61. deletionState
  62. }
  63. fragment botHelpers_useViewerCanAccessPrivateBot on Bot {
  64. isPrivateBot
  65. viewerIsCreator
  66. }
粤ICP备19079148号